    L.Harmony reacted to Cervidae in Has your Marriage Changed Since Surgery?   
    I'm not married, but I have been dating the same person for about 4 years. We met online (playing World of Warcraft, funnily enough XD) and I was TERRIFIED to meet him in person for obvious reasons. He was dating me at my highest weight - over 400 pounds, and I've sort of always wondered, in some deep, dark, self-hating place, if he ever felt like he settled for me, or if he just "puts up with" my body because he loves me. Does he ever feel trapped or like it's worth not being attracted to me because of how much we love each other? I think it's really normal for people who have had to deal with the things we have had to deal with the fear these things. It's not easy, socially speaking, to be fat, especially for women. Intimacy can be like this giant monster we must fight every day. Since losing over a hundred pounds and gaining so much confidence, I've come to realize that this person who loves me and has cared for me through thick and thin (hahahah) would simply not be here if he didn't want to be. And when I lose another hundred pounds, if he starts showing more interest or attraction to me, I think I will be happy instead of hurt or offended, because he could have chosen to leave at any time based on my body, but he never did. A year ago, I would have been hurt and offended at the very thought of him being more attracted to my smaller form. But now I feel that while every version of us is still part of who we are, none of those versions define us as human beings. I don't think he's attracted to me when I'm throwing up, for example, but he still loves me and takes care of me because he wants to. In the end, that is what matters. Your body is just a meat suit that houses your soul, and a person who loves you will love all versions of you equally.
